Allen Media’s ‘Mathis Court’ Set To Launch With Over 90% U.S. Clearance

Host Judge Greg Mathis will actively partner with TV stations to provide legal commentary and insights to current news stories when the new show debuts this fall.

First-run syndicated programming supplier Allen Media Group says it has reached more than 90% U.S. distribution for its eighth and newest court series Mathis Court with Judge Mathis. The new court series is a daily one-hour strip for fall 2023, available to broadcast TV stations.

In less than a month, Mathis Court with Judge Mathis has secured clearances with stations from television groups including: Nexstar (including WPIX New York), Tegna, Weigel, Scripps, Hearst, Gray, Cox Media Group, Woods Communications, Cunningham, Griffin, Coastal Broadcasting, Cowles Company, Lockwood, Graham, Lilly, Corridor Television, American Spirit and Allen Media Group Television.

Integral to the launch of Mathis Court with Judge Mathis will be Judge Greg Mathis himself, a former judge of Michigan’s 36th District Court. Mathis will make himself available to news departments of station partners to offer his legal commentary pertaining to locally significant and newsworthy legal cases. This promotional campaign by Mathis is part of AMG’s commitment to publicize Mathis Court with Judge Mathis exclusively in broadcast TV markets across the country, and, it says, “providing this content will add value and give local newscasts more connection with prominent national and regional stories.”
